Limp Bizkit, frontman Fred Durst and Flawless Records have filed a joint lawsuit against Universal Music Group (UMG), accusing the music company behemoth of withholding music streaming royalties.
Limp Bizkit is suing Universal Music Group for many years of unpaid royalties, leading to a staggering amount in damages.
The suit contends that despite Limp Bizkit selling millions of albums, the group has never received any royalties from UMG.
